    1Ap—0 to 20 centimeters (0.0 to 7.9 inches); brown (10YR 4/3) interior silt loam; weak fine granular structure; friable; 5.5 very fine and fine roots and 5.5 medium roots; fragments; moderately acid, pH 5.8, hellige-truog; abrupt smooth boundary. 5% rock fragments.; many very fine and fine roots; many medium roots
    1Bt1—20 to 43 centimeters (7.9 to 16.9 inches); yellowish brown (10YR 5/6) interior silty clay loam; weak fine and medium subangular blocky structure; friable; 2.5 very fine and fine roots and 2.5 medium roots; 15 percent distinct , moist, clay films on faces of peds and in pores; fragments; moderately acid, pH 5.8, hellige-truog; clear wavy boundary. Lab sample # 88P01560. 5% rock fragments.; few clay films surface features on faces of peds and in pores; common very fine and fine roots; common medium roots
    1Bt2—43 to 66 centimeters (16.9 to 26.0 inches); strong brown (7.5YR 5/6) interior silty clay loam; 1 percent light gray (10YR 7/2) medium prominent mottles; moderate fine and medium subangular blocky structure; friable; 0.5 very fine roots; 15 percent distinct , moist, clay films on faces of peds and in pores; fragments; strongly acid, pH 5.3, hellige-truog; clear wavy boundary. Lab sample # 88P01561. 5% rock fragments.; few clay films surface features on faces of peds and in pores; few very fine roots; few medium prominent 10YR72 mottles
    1Bt3—66 to 94 centimeters (26.0 to 37.0 inches); strong brown (7.5YR 5/6) interior silty clay; 1 percent light gray (10YR 7/2) medium prominent mottles; weak coarse prismatic, and moderate medium platy structure; firm; 37 percent distinct , moist, clay films on faces of peds and in pores; fragments; very strongly acid, pH 4.8, hellige-truog; clear wavy boundary. 10% coarse fragments.; common clay films surface features on faces of peds and in pores; few medium prominent 10YR72 mottles
    1BC—94 to 117 centimeters (37.0 to 46.1 inches); strong brown (7.5YR 5/6) interior silty clay loam; 1 percent light gray (2.5Y 7/2) medium prominent and 11 percent yellowish red (5YR 5/6) medium and coarse faint and 11 percent brownish yellow (10YR 6/8) medium and coarse prominent mottles; weak coarse prismatic structure; firm; fragments; very strongly acid, pH 4.8, hellige-truog; clear smooth boundary. Lab sample # 88P01562. 20% rock fragments.; common medium and coarse faint 5YR56 mottles; common medium and coarse prominent 10YR68 mottles; few medium prominent 2.5Y72 mottles
    1Cr—117 to 165 centimeters (46.1 to 65.0 inches); pale olive (5Y 6/3) interior and light brownish gray (10YR 6/2) interior and dark reddish brown (5YR 3/4) interior weathered bedrock; fragments. Lab sample # 88P01562
